The Cancellation of Listing Agreement form for Florida with a broker in Minnesota is a crucial document that facilitates the termination of a real estate listing agreement between a seller and a broker. This form outlines the mutual agreement between the parties to terminate the listing agreement and clarifies that the broker waives any claims against the seller following the termination. Key features include the date of termination, the acknowledgment of any expenses incurred prior to termination, and the release of obligations for both parties. Filling out the form requires inserting the names of the broker and seller, relevant addresses, and specific dates. This form is particularly useful for attorneys, partners, owners, associates, paralegals, and legal assistants in the real estate sector, as it ensures a clear and legally binding conclusion to the listing agreement while safeguarding the rights and responsibilities of both parties. It serves as an essential tool in real estate transactions, particularly when a seller decides to change brokers or withdraw their property from the market.

A listing cancellation form is used to formally request the cancellation of an existing listing agreement between a seller and a real estate agent. This form can be used to terminate the listing agreement before it expires, or to cancel the agreement after its expiration date.

Whether you change your mind about selling, have ethical or performance concerns about the agent, or you just don't find a buyer, you can get out of a listing agreement.

You should use the Listing Cancellation Form when you wish to terminate an existing listing agreement with your real estate agent.

If you`re a homeowner in Florida who needs to cancel your listing agreement, there are several steps you need to take: Review your listing agreement. Notify your real estate agent in writing. Get a mutual release. Work with a real estate attorney.

An online cancellation form basically includes the terms and conditions of the cancellation, the steps that must be taken by the customer in order to cancel, and asks for necessary information, such as customer name, contact details, or client ID.

In general, valid reasons for terminating a listing agreement include: A) Mutual agreement between the seller and agent, B) Completion of the sale, and C) Expiration of the agreed-upon time period, as these reasons reflect the successful conclusion or mutual termination of the contract.
